    CHAMPAIGN, Ill. (WMBD) — The Normal Community Ironmen beat the Palatine Pirates in the 2024 IHSA Boys Basketball State Championship Semi-finals Class 4A game at The State Farm Center in Champaign on Friday.

    The final score was currently 58 to 38.

    The score was 46 to 30 after the third quarter in favor of the Ironmen, 27 to 22  in favor of the Ironmen at the half and was tied at 13 to 13 after the first Quarter.

    The Ironmen will play either Flossmoor or Winnetka in the 4A State Championship on Saturday.
